wheel \wheel\, v. t. imp. p. p. wheeled; p. pr. vb. n.
wheeling.
1913 webster
1. to convey on wheels, or in a wheeled vehicle; as, to wheel
a load of hay or wood.
1913 webster
2. to put into a rotatory motion; to cause to turn or
revolve; to cause to gyrate; to make or perform in a
circle. "the beetle wheels her droning flight." --gray.
1913 webster
now heaven, in all her glory, shone, and rolled
her motions, as the great first mover's hand
first wheeled their course. --milton.

wheeled \wheeled\, a.
having wheels; -- used chiefly in composition; as, a
four-wheeled carriage.
